HC Deb 24 February 2004 vol 418 cc362-3W
Alan Simpson

To ask the Secretary of State for Defence what the estimated costs of plans to upgrade nuclear weapons design and production facilities at Aldermaston are; how much has been allocated for this upgrade; and what the timetable is for its completion. [154079]

Mr. Hoon

The refurbishment and replacement of older facilities, and the decommissioning of those no longer required, is a continuing programme of work at AWE to meet safety, regulatory and operational requirements. We made clear in paragraph 3.11 of the Defence White Paper published in December (CM 6041—1) that we will take appropriate steps to ensure that the range of options for maintaining a nuclear deterrent capability is kept open until we need to take decisions on whether to replace Trident.

The costs of the continuing programme are included in the overall incentivised price of the 25-year AWE Management and Operation contract. The precise timing, scope and cost of all the investments required over the 25 year period have yet to be finalised with the AWE contractor. The total cost of operating AWE for the current financial year is expected to be of the order of £310 million.
